推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文主要讨论了在不同Linux发行版之间迁移数据的艺术。由于Linux发行版众多,且各自的特点和优缺点不同,因此迁移数据可能会面临一些挑战。本文提供了一些技巧和工具,以便用户能够更顺利地在不同的Linux发行版之间迁移数据。
Linux作为一个多元化的操作系统,拥有众多发行版,每个发行版都有其独特的特点和用户群,对于Linux用户来说,在不同发行版之间迁移,有时是必要的需求,比如因为工作需求、个人喜好或其他原因,这个过程可能会面临不少挑战,本文将探讨在不同Linux发行版之间迁移时可能遇到的问题,并提供解决方案,帮助用户顺利完成迁移。
我们需要了解,Linux发行版之间的差异并不仅仅是外观和主题,不同的发行版可能会使用不同的软件包管理器,例如Debian系列使用dpkg,Red Hat系列使用yum或dnf,Arch Linux使用pacman等,默认的shell、启动管理器以及桌面环境也可能不同,这些差异可能导致用户在迁移过程中遇到问题。
对于大多数用户来说,迁移的第一步是将现有的用户数据和配置文件备份,这包括个人文件、文档、应用程序设置等,可以使用通用的文件备份工具,如tar、cpio或rsync来实现,也可以考虑使用特定于发行版的工具,例如Debian系列的dpkg-deb,Red Hat系列的rpm2cpio等。
在迁移过程中,软件包管理器的差异可能会带来问题,如果一个用户从Debian迁移到Red Hat,他可能需要将.deb软件包转换为.rpm软件包,这可以通过使用如dpkg2rpm或apt-rpm等工具来实现,同样,如果用户从Red Hat迁移到Debian,可以使用rpm2deb工具。
桌面环境和启动管理器的差异也可能影响用户的使用体验,如果用户从Fedora迁移到Ubuntu,他可能需要适应从Systemd到Upstart的改变,在这种情况下,用户可能需要手动启动和停止服务,或者寻找可以自动处理这些差异的工具。
除了技术上的挑战,用户在使用不同发行版之间迁移时,还可能面临社区支持和文档资源的不足,这要求用户具备一定的Linux知识和问题解决能力。
跨越不同Linux发行版之间的迁移是一项充满挑战的任务,用户需要做好充分的准备,包括备份用户数据、了解目标发行版的特点,并准备好应对可能遇到的问题,在这个过程中,一些通用的工具和特定于发行版的工具可以提供帮助,用户也需要不断提升自己的Linux技能,以便更好地应对迁移过程中可能遇到的问题。
关键词:Linux, 发行版, 迁移, 软件包管理器, 桌面环境, 启动管理器, 备份, 转换软件包, 社区支持, 问题解决能力
本文标签属性:
不同Linux发行版之间的迁移:linux各个发行版区别